Language

Portugal's official language is portuguese. English is widelly spoken in turistical areas and by people under 35, as it is tought in schools. The older the people, the smaller is the probability they speak english. Due to the similarity to spanish (castelan) it is easily understood and spoken in Portugal (it's a sort of portuspanish...). Although seldomly, it is also possible to find some french and german speakers. Portuguese people are usually warm and will most of the times do an effort to help a lost traveller.


Money

Since 2001 Portugal has adopted the euro. Former currency was the escudo. In turistical areas, like Cascais and Lisbon, it is possible to find exchange offices on the streets. Cash machines are widelly spread and accept most of the card networks.
